In this paper, we study three-dimensional homogeneous paracontact metric manifolds for which the Reeb vector field of the underlying paracontact structure satisfies a nullity condition. We give example of paraSasakian and non-paraSasakian [Formula: see text]-manifolds. Finally, we exhibit explicit example of [Formula: see text]-Einstein manifolds.

AbstractWe completely classify three-dimensional Lorentz manifolds, curvature homogeneous up to order one, equipped with Einstein-like metrics. New examples arise with respect to both homogeneous examples and three-dimensional Lorentz manifolds admitting a degenerate parallel null line field.

The paper presents a summary of the results obtained by C. J. Cohen and E. C. Hubbard, who established by numerical integration that a resonance relation exists between the orbits of Neptune and Pluto. The problem may be explored further by approximating the motion of Pluto by that of a particle with negligible mass in the three-dimensional (circular) restricted problem. The mass of Pluto and the eccentricity of Neptune's orbit are ignored in this approximation. Significant features of the problem appear to be the presence of two critical arguments and the possibility that the orbit may be related to a periodic orbit of the third kind.
